Latest Patents
Österle holds a patent for an osteosynthesis screw, which features a shaft with a thread and a head formed at one end, equipped with a notch for a tool. The shaft region has a trilobular configuration with a uniform thickness. This design prevents inverse rotation due to rapid tissue growth, enhancing the effectiveness of the screw in surgical applications. He has 1 patent to his name.
